The Art and Science of Hardwood Flooring Installation in North Stamford

Installing hardwood floors is a craft that requires precision, expertise, and a keen understanding of both the material and the environment. Local flooring professionals in North Stamford approach this task with meticulous attention to detail, ensuring a flawless and long-lasting finish for your investment. The process typically begins with a thorough site assessment of your home, including inspecting the subfloor for any imperfections and determining the optimal layout for the chosen wood planks. Ventilation and climate control are also key considerations, especially given the New England seasons that North Stamford experiences.

Following the assessment, the installers will prepare the subfloor, which may involve cleaning, leveling, or reinforcing it to provide a stable base. This is a crucial step for preventing issues like squeaking or warping down the line. Once the subfloor is ready, the hardwood planks are carefully laid out, often following specific patterns like straight lay, herringbone, or diagonal to best suit the room’s aesthetics and dimensions. Depending on the type of hardwood chosen, installation can involve several techniques.

Traditional Nail-Down Installation

This is a widely used method for solid hardwood floors. Installer’s use specialized nail guns to secure each plank to the wooden subfloor. This technique provides a very secure and stable installation, ideal for areas with heavy foot traffic. It’s a time-tested method that ensures the longevity of your hardwood floors, a significant consideration for families in busy North Stamford households.

Glue-Down Installation

For engineered hardwood flooring or installations over concrete subfloors, adhesive is the preferred method. A high-quality flooring adhesive is applied to the subfloor, and the planks are then pressed firmly into place. This method creates a strong bond and is particularly effective in basements or areas prone to moisture fluctuations, offering a reliable solution for diverse North Stamford home environments.

Floating Floors

Engineered hardwood floors can also be installed as floating floors, where planks are joined together via a click-lock system or glued at the edges. This method allows the entire floor to move as a single unit, making it an excellent choice for areas with radiant heating systems or where expansion and contraction are a concern. It’s a less invasive installation process, often preferred for quicker renovations in neighborhoods like Springdale or Westover.

Choosing the Right Hardwood for Your North Stamford Residence

North Stamford’s diverse architectural landscape means there’s a hardwood option to suit every taste and dwelling. From the classic elegance of Oak and Maple to the exotic richness of Walnut and Brazilian Cherry, the choices are vast. Engineered hardwood, with its stable construction, is also a popular choice, offering the beauty of natural wood with enhanced resistance to humidity changes.

  • Oak: A perennial favorite, available in red and white varieties, offering durability and a classic grain pattern.
  • Maple: Known for its smooth texture and light color, it provides a clean, modern aesthetic.
  • Hickory: Offering a distinct grain and excellent hardness, it’s a robust choice for high-traffic areas.
  • Walnut: With its rich, dark tones and elegant grain, walnut adds a touch of luxury to any room.
  • Engineered Hardwood: A versatile option constructed with a real wood veneer over a stable core, ideal for varying humidity levels often found in the New England climate.

Frequently Asked Questions About Hardwood Flooring Installation

How long does hardwood flooring installation typically take in North Stamford?

The duration of hardwood flooring installation can vary based on the size of the area, the type of hardwood chosen, and the complexity of the installation. For an average-sized room in a North Stamford home, basic installation can take anywhere from one to three days. More intricate patterns or custom work may require additional time. Your local flooring professional will provide a more precise timeline after assessing your project.

Can hardwood floors be installed over existing flooring in North Stamford?

In some cases, yes, but it depends on the type of existing flooring. For example, thin engineered hardwood or laminate can sometimes be installed over existing vinyl or tile. However, installing over wall-to-wall carpeting is generally not recommended. A professional assessment is crucial to determine the suitability of your current subfloor or flooring for a new hardwood installation. What Hardwood Flooring Installation Looks Like

Installation begins with acclimating the hardwood to the room's humidity for 3–7 days; the subfloor is checked for level and any squeaks or soft spots are addressed; boards are blind-nailed or stapled to the subfloor starting from the straightest reference wall; borders and transitions are cut to fit; the floor is sanded and finished in place or pre-finished boards are installed ready to walk on

Can I install Hardwood Flooring Installation myself?

Flooring enthusiasts with the right tools can successfully install pre-finished click-lock hardwood; nail-down hardwood requires a flooring nailer and significant effort on anything but a simple rectangular room; in-place sanding and finishing is not realistic DIY due to equipment requirements

EPA Radon Zone 1 — What It Means for Fairfield County Hardwood Flooring Installation

Fairfield County is designated EPA Radon Zone 1 — the highest potential for elevated indoor radon (4+ pCi/L per EPA action level). Glue-down or nail-down hardwood over a slab or subfloor covers the most common radon entry points (slab cracks, floor-wall joints). In a Zone 1 county, EPA recommends a radon test before installation — if levels are elevated, sub-slab depressurization should be installed before the floor is laid, since pulling up finished hardwood later to remediate is costly.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, Map of Radon Zones, 2024.
